Summary
Predicted to enable DNA-binding transcription factor activity, RNA polymerase II-specific and RNA polymerase II cis-regulatory region sequence-specific DNA binding activity. Acts upstream of or within blood vessel development and forebrain development. Predicted to be located in nucleus. Is expressed in forebrain. Orthologous to human NPAS4 (neuronal PAS domain protein 4). [provided by Alliance of Genome Resources, Jan 2025]
